Will said: 
 
"16 gage is rated for 10 amperes in conduit" 
 
Conduit is a closed space.  An open space, especially with air blowing 
over 
it, will allow considerably higher current.
  Indeed, Colin.  I use #22 Cu at 15A in TL-922s for dropping the 
filament V from >5.3V to c. 4.8V, and it runs less warm than a 1/4W 
resistor.  However, transformers are a whole nuther ballgame because 
the thermal resistance is much higher.
